Resume Writing Tips for Senior Counsellor

Crafting a compelling resume is crucial for senior counsellors aiming to progress their careers in a competitive job market. A strong resume not only highlights your expertise but showcases your leadership, strategic impact, and ability to foster positive change. Whether applying to educational institutions, healthcare organizations, or corporate settings, your resume is the first impression that opens doors to meaningful roles.

Introduction

Senior counsellor roles demand a blend of deep interpersonal skills, strategic thinking, and measurable outcomes that improve client or organizational wellbeing. A well-crafted resume extends beyond listing duties—it narrates your professional journey, emphasizing your impact, leadership, and specialized competencies. Because hiring managers often skim resumes for seconds, clarity, relevance, and strong results-oriented content are vital. Additionally, many companies use ATS (Applicant Tracking System) software that filters resumes based on keywords and format, making optimization essential. This blog integrates practical advice and examples to help senior counsellors build powerful resumes that stand out both to humans and machines.

1. Resume Summary

Your resume summary is the elevator pitch that immediately conveys your value proposition. For senior counsellors, it should succinctly highlight your years of experience, areas of specialization (e.g., career counselling, mental health, crisis intervention), and leadership capabilities. Incorporate quantifiable achievements or a demonstration of your impact to grab attention.

Example: “Experienced Senior Counsellor with 10+ years in educational and clinical settings, skilled in developing personalized career plans that have increased client success rates by 25%. Proven leader managing counselling teams of 5+ professionals, adept at program design and data-driven outcome improvement.”

2. Key Skills

List a robust set of relevant skills that reflect your expertise and match job descriptions. Use a mix of soft skills and technical competencies. Choose keywords carefully to optimize for ATS scans.

  • Career Development Planning
  • Crisis Intervention Strategies
  • Client Needs Assessment
  • Conflict Resolution
  • Leadership & Team Management
  • Psychological Counseling Techniques
  • Data Analysis & Reporting
  • Behavioral Assessment Tools
  • Multicultural Competency
  • Case Management Software (e.g., Penelope, Apricot)

3. Achievements vs. Responsibilities

Instead of simply listing your duties, focus on accomplishments that demonstrate your effectiveness. Hiring managers want to see results and the tangible impact you’ve made. Use numbers, percentages, or qualitative data where possible. For example, mention improvements in client outcomes, program expansion, or resource optimization.

Example Bullet Point: “Led a mental health counselling program that increased client retention rates by 30% through personalized intervention plans and innovative group therapy sessions.”

4. Tailor to Job

Customize your resume for each application by aligning your skills and experiences with the job description. Analyze the specific keywords and required competencies the employer lists and mirror their language while maintaining honesty. This approach improves ATS ranking and shows recruiters your clear fit for the role.

6. Metrics

  • Percentage increase in client success or retention rates
  • Number of counselling sessions or clients managed per month/year
  • Reduction rates in crises or behavioral incidents
  • Team leadership metrics, e.g., size of team managed, increase in team efficiency
  • Program participation growth or budget optimization percentages

7. Education

  • Relevant degrees, e.g., Master’s in Counseling, Psychology, Social Work
  • Certifications such as Licensed Professional Counselor (LPC), National Certified Counselor (NCC), or Certified Career Counselor (CCC)

8. Format

  • Use clear section headings and bullet points for readability
  • Stick to a professional font (e.g., Arial, Calibri, Times New Roman) and keep font size 10-12 pt
  • Maintain consistent spacing and margins to fill up 1-2 pages without crowding
  • Avoid graphics or tables that might confuse ATS scanning
  • Save and submit your resume as a Word document (.doc or .docx) unless PDF is requested

9. Concise

Keep your resume focused and compact. Senior roles require depth but avoid overwhelming recruiters with long paragraphs. Use short, impactful phrases and focus on the last 10-15 years of work experience if lengthy.
